Becoming Review

Becoming by Michelle Obama is a memoir about origin, effort, and the work of becoming someone in public without losing the private self. Published in 2018, it moves from a South Side apartment to the White House and beyond. For you, this book offers warmth and candor: ambition framed by service, partnership balanced with independence, and leadership grounded in listening.

Overview

The narrative follows three arcs: Becoming Me, Becoming Us, and Becoming More. You will notice the everyday detail: school recitals, law firm hallways, campaign buses, quiet dinners after loud days. The tone is reflective rather than dramatic, with attention to how choices shape character over time.

Summary

Michelle Robinson grows up in a tight knit family that prizes education and steadiness. She builds a career in law and public service, meets Barack Obama, and navigates marriage alongside two demanding careers. The campaign years test privacy and patience; the First Lady years turn projects like healthy eating and military families into national work. Without spoiling intimate moments, the book closes on transition and purpose: life after office as another chapter, not an epilogue.

Key Themes

You will see identity as layered: daughter, professional, partner, mother, citizen. You will see resilience built from routine and community. You will consider visibility: the costs and uses of being seen. You will meet leadership as service rather than spotlight.

Strengths and Weaknesses

Strengths: approachable prose, strong sense of place, and a practical vision of purpose. Weaknesses: policy is background rather than focus and the even tone may feel careful to readers seeking sharper edges. Overall: a steady, humane memoir that invites reflection.
